1. The Knowledge Seeker
On NOVEMBER 18th, 2021, I will publish The Knowledge Seeker. This 90,000 word, young-adult, dystopian novel is not related to the Ben Archer series.
Termite is a sixteen-year-old boy who has dreamed of becoming a Knowledge Seeker all his life. He dreams of saving ancient books from the ruins of our civilization, which perished 600-years ago.
Virtual information has vanished, along with electricity, and only the information in the books could pull survivors out of a second Dark Ages.
But knowledge is power, and the Wraith King knows this all too well. He will stop at nothing to become the sole master of this knowledge, with the aim of submitting humanity to servitude.
When Termite becomes the last Seeker, he must find a way to spread knowledge back to the world, or die trying.

What is an ARC reader?
An ARC reader receives an Advanced Review Copy of The Knowledge Seeker in exchange for leaving an honest review (typically on Amazon and/or Goodreads) once the book is available for distribution.
